0

只是似乎无法让这个工具提示显示我哪里出错了?,css正在工作但工具提示没有?

$(document).ready(function() {
    $('#mc_embed_signup').on('ajax:error', function() {  
         var $inputField = $(this).find('input[name="email"]')
        $inputField.addClass('error_field');
        $inputField.tooltip({
        position: "center right",
        offset: [-2, 10],
        effect: "fade",
        opacity: 0.7,
        content: "This email is all ready registered"
        });
    });
});
4

1 回答 1

0

以防万一其他人通过第二次调用 tooltip('show') 解决了同样的问题并将内容更改为标题:似乎文档并不那么清楚,因为人们会假设第一次调用会完成这项工作。

$(document).ready(function() {
$('#mc_embed_signup').on('ajax:error', function() {  
     var $inputField = $(this).find('input[name="email"]')
    $inputField.addClass('error_field');
    $inputField.tooltip({
    position: "center right",
    offset: [-2, 10],
    effect: "fade",
    opacity: 0.7,
    title: "This email is all ready registered"
    });
    $inputField.tooltip('show');
});

});

于 2013-10-28T13:55:11.637 回答